Overview

Official protocol title:

PHASE III STUDY OF DARATUMUMAB/RHUPH20 (NSC- 810307) + LENALIDOMIDE OR LENALIDOMIDE AS POST-AUTOLOGOUS STEM CELL TRANSPLANT MAINTENANCE THERAPY IN PATIENTS WITH MULTIPLE MYELOMA (MM) USING MINIMAL RESIDUAL DISEASE TO DIRECT THERAPY DURATION (DRAMMATIC STUDY)

Intervention/treatment:
DARZALEX SC
Medical condition:
MULTIPLE MYELOMA
Protocol code:
MYC.2 / S1803
Control number:
261824
Status:
Active, not recruiting
Approved:
April 08, 2022
Trial phase:
Phase 3
